Transaction 74a7f70dc66ee5fc4efa9d5b637a57750fa483d906e1ce294523e2c3a8044410

2 Input
2 Outputs
  • 74a7f70dc66ee5fc4efa9d5b637a57750fa483d906e1ce294523e2c3a8044410:0
  • value  1502
    address  12TukPMRE3YfgrmJ9RGR4KXtYAnhqjJzz4
  • 74a7f70dc66ee5fc4efa9d5b637a57750fa483d906e1ce294523e2c3a8044410:1
  • value  20547561
    address  19gehPxbDoXuNFzLUEGYrkTrdZYdgDdQDL